Car companies’ shares in pre-conference trading in the US are sinking

Shares of Chinese electric vehicle maker Nio Inc. fell 3.5 percent in pre-conference trading as data showed a new drop in car sales in China in January for the eighth straight month.

The Chinese Automobile Manufacturers Association said passenger car sales were down 4.4% from a year earlier, and said sales were expected to remain sluggish in February.

Other Chinese electric vehicle manufacturers are also falling pre-conference in the US.

Xpeng Inc recorded losses of 2.28%, Li Auto 2.81%. US Tesla is also down 1.90%, as in 2021 it earned 25.7% of its total revenue from China, recording revenue of 13.84 billion dollars from the country.
